The Yokogawa ALR121‑S50 S1 is a serial communication module designed for deployment within Yokogawa Field Control Station (FCS) platforms. It enables reliable communication using RS‑422 or RS‑485 interfaces, and supports functions such as Modbus slave and subsystem communications (e.g. sequencing systems), facilitating data exchange between the FCS and external subsystems or supervisory systems.
This dual‑port module provides both point‑to‑point (RS‑422) and multipoint (RS‑485) communication, with robust industrial-grade performance and seamless integration into Yokogawa’s control architecture.
| Item | Specification |
|---|---|
| Model | ALR121-S50 S1 |
| Module Type | Serial Communication Module |
| Communication Interfaces | RS-422 (point-to-point), RS-485 (multipoint) |
| Number of Ports | 2 |
| Communication Mode | Half-duplex |
| Synchronization | Start-stop synchronization |
| Baud Rates Supported | 1200 / 2400 / 4800 / 9600 / 19200 / 38400 bps |
| Character Format | 7 or 8 bits |
| Parity Options | None, Even, Odd |
| Stop Bits | 1 or 2 |
| Transmission Distance | RS-422: ~15 m, RS-485: ~1200 m |
| Communication Functions | Modbus Slave, Subsystem Communication |
| Redundancy | Dual-redundant supported |
| Mounting Compatibility | AFV30/40, A2FV50/70, ANB10/11 |
| Power Consumption | Approx. 0.5 A |
| Dimensions | 126.7 × 32.8 × 130 mm |
| Weight | 0.3 kg |
